Transaction 987e16fa8ab8135a0c76f9f703f6f69c5634924e32d48eda53d3a75ddbfe5c21
1 Input
1 Output
-
987e16fa8ab8135a0c76f9f703f6f69c5634924e32d48eda53d3a75ddbfe5c21:0
- value
- 3482318
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ac2ba49dfe9881f936dad0779299918e42a8c273 OP_EQUAL
- address
- 3HPNRuj598RwhtA1VR5oDtX35wwmX3hqvD